Provides strategic leadership and oversight for the Ag Services business across a defined regional market to achieve product line, profitability, and growth objectives. Leads and develops a team of Farm Managers and support staff to ensure effective delivery of property management, real estate sales, and related services. Accountable for the financial performance, operational efficiency, and risk management of regional farm real estate activities. Cultivates key client relationships, drives new business development, and collaborates across Wealth Management, Insurance Group, and Bank divisions to deliver comprehensive client solutions.
Respon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
- Leads and develops Farm Managers and Administrative Assistants across multiple locations, providing direction, coaching, and oversight. Responsible for staffing, training, performance management, and team development to ensure consistent execution of Company standards and operational goals.
- Participates in the development of regional goals & objectives and is responsible for monitoring variances and controlling the budget.
- Prepares/analyzes financial and business operations reports; oversees Management Control and Real Estate Trust Investment Committee activity and reports regional results.
- Directs the planning, development and implementation of necessary policies/procedures within the department for optimal operation.
- Manages real estate property and financial receivable assets, and performs real estate sales with broker guidance, following all related administrative and investment policies and provisions of all governing documents, including assessing property leases/contracts with respect to client's goals, risk profile, and financial situation; negotiates leases/contracts; manages execution of terms; assesses appropriate types & levels of insurance; and monitors environmental issues and risk management.
- Obtains proper owner authorization and variables for property sale; and manages the processes with other brokers and attorneys to complete the sale.
- Manages the acceptance process for new real estate-related assets into Trust accounts, and for new property management and real estate brokerage agency agreements, following all relevant division policies and procedures for environmental status and authority assessment, documentation and recordkeeping requirements.
- Performs real estate-oriented advisory and special services for fee income, including obtaining proper authorization for requested task, assigning scope of service and setting fee; performing services according to client specifications (Trust documentation, etc.); and billing/collection of fees, and posting to correct account.
- Generates new business for the real estate product line, and in Wealth Management, Insurance Group, and Bank areas by contacting potential customers, responding to requests/inquiries, implementing appropriate sales techniques, and making qualified referrals. Achieves new business fee and cross-referral goals.
- Maintains awareness of economic, financial and industrial trends as well as area competitive factors affecting all types of real estate assets.
- Promotes continuity of customer relationships among accounts by coverage and back-up assistance.
- Encourages a high level of morale and effort within the organization and provides leadership and training necessary for the development of other professional and support staff.
- Participates in special projects or task force assignments for planning and development activities.
Qualifications
Education/Experience
- Bachelor's degree in Agriculture, Finance, Business Administration or a related field, practical knowledge of crop production and marketing and the equivalent of five plus years of experience in industry.
- Illinois Real Estate Broker License (Managing Broker License preferred); AFM preferred; ALC a plus.
- Minimum of 3-5 years of progressive leadership or supervisory experience required; experience managing hybrid or multi-location teams strongly preferred.
Skills:
- High level of analytical skills to conduct farm account analysis and maintain account's progress in consideration of market trends, interest rates, economic conditions and other factors.
- Ability to effectively manage and supervise personnel.
- Strong oral and written communication skills.
- High level of interpersonal skills to interact with internal and external customers and potential customers in a professional manner.
